Former Icelandic President Olafur Grimsson has warned that any U.S. attempt to forcibly seize Greenland would lead to significant repercussions for both the Western alliance and the global order. His comments come amid heightened rhetoric from former President Trump regarding the territory. The situation raises concerns about geopolitical stability in the Arctic region.

Greenland, an autonomous territory of Denmark, has strategic significance due to its location and resources. The U.S. has shown interest in Greenland in the past, notably during Trump's presidency, raising questions about sovereignty and international law. The geopolitical landscape in the Arctic is changing, with increasing interest from various nations.
